Eye Strain and Accommodation Fatigue
Physically, keeping your eyes open continuously taxes the ocular muscles responsible for focusing—especially the ciliary muscles that adjust lens shape, a process called accommodation. After sustained effort, your eyes may develop fatigue, dryness, and blurred vision due to incomplete relaxation of these muscles. Additionally, prolonged exposure to light accelerates wear on the retina and lens, potentially increasing the risk of long-term conditions like cataracts or age-related macular degeneration—though no conclusive evidence links a single 17-hour session to permanent damage, chronic overexposure does contribute over time.

Sleep Deprivation Consequences
Hours spent awake without rest inevitably suppress sleep homeostasis, the body’s drive to sleep. Chronic sleep loss compromises immune function, emotional regulation, and metabolic health. Even if only 17 hours pass, the cumulative effect of insufficient rest over days or weeks leads to symptoms like irritability, reduced insulin sensitivity, and heightened stress hormones such as cortisol.
